The new art exhibition ‘Drawn From The Edge’ by Mick Armson is being officially opened at Tenby Museum and Art Gallery tomorrow (Saturday).

Over the last thirty years Mick has explored the “seemingly endless visual wonder” of the Pembrokeshire Coast through drawing, painting and printmaking

His studio is situated on the south bank of The River Thames in Greenwich, next to The Thames Barrier. This riverside location also provides constant inspiration for his work.

As a result, he has had a long held ambition to exhibit a body of work at Tenby Museum and Art Gallery that brings together his work inspired by both of these locations, and beyond.

‘Drawn From The Edge’ includes drawings, paintings and original prints, inspired by land meeting water.

This ranges from the natural landscape where bodies of water sculpt the land, relatively unaffected by direct human touch – to cityscapes, harbours and coastal development where the existence of sea, river or lake has been the prime reason for shores and banks to be utilised for human settlement, trade and industry.

Mick’s drawings and paintings are all made on location. He shows these alongside his lino prints, etchings and monotypes, “as they all inform each other”.

“In the landscape, having decided on composition, I initially work quite quickly and spontaneously with broad areas of colour,” he said.

“I then work on top of that with ink or pencil, followed by more concentrated colour work and further linear work and so on. So the image builds up in layers of refinement, which relates closely to the process of printmaking”.

Mick has consistently used printmaking to further develop the work he has done outside.

“I love the methodical process in producing original prints, which still allows for spontaneity and the opportunity to embrace the unexpected,” he continued.

His Lino Print ‘RNLI Tenby’ has been in the permanent collection of Tenby Museum & Art Gallery since 2010, when Mick ran the London Marathon for the RNLI - his limited edition print raising £3700 in sponsorship.

‘Drawn From The Edge’ is an opportunity to enjoy much more of his work and includes many images of the Pembrokeshire coastline, Tenby Harbour and Caldey Island.

It also includes sketchbooks, artefacts and ephemera providing an insight into Mick Armson’s process of seeing, drawing, painting and printmaking.
